表情符号在我们可能需要在代码中处理的文本中频繁出现。例如,这可能是在我们使用电子邮件或即时消息服务时。
在本教程中,我们将看到在Java应用程序中检测表情符号的多种方法。
2. Java如何表示表情符号?
每个表情符号都有一个独特的Unicode值来表示它。Java使用UTF-16在_String_中对Unicode字符进行编码。
UTF-16可以对所有Unicode代码点进行编码。一个代码点可能由一个或两个代码单元组成。如果需要两个,因为Unicode值超出了我们可以在16位中存储的范围,那么我们称它为代理对。
大约 4 分钟